Mitenkä saan tehtyä laskurin, joka tietyn ehdon täytyttyä alkaa laskea sekunteja?
Elikkä jos esim soluun E1 tulee tulokseksi 1, niin silloin solussa F1 alkaa laskuri laskea nollasta ylöspäin sekunteja.
laskuri
2
85
Vastaukset
ko. taulukon moduuliin...
Option Explicit
Private Sub Worksheet_Calculate()
If Range("E1") = 1 Then
Aloita
Else
Lopeta
End If
End Sub
moduuliin...
Option Explicit
Dim Ok As Boolean
Sub Aloita()
Ok = True
Application.OnTime Now() TimeValue("00:00:01"), "Ajastin"
End Sub
Sub Lopeta()
Ok = False
Worksheets("Sheet1").Range("F1").Value = 0
End Sub
Sub Ajastin()
If Ok Then
Worksheets("Sheet1").Range("F1").Value = Worksheets("Sheet1").Range("F1").Value 1
Application.OnTime Now() TimeValue("00:00:01"), "Ajastin"
End If
End Sub
KeepEXCELing
@Kunde- harjottelua
Kiitti vastauksesta!!
Täytyy illalla kokeilla vielä miten toimii.
Ketjusta on poistettu 0 sääntöjenvastaista viestiä.
Luetuimmat keskustelut
V*ttuu että mä haluan sua
Jos jotain ihmistä voi kunnolla haluta, niin hän on se. Voi Luoja auta jo! Joku jeesus hjelppa mej!1055754Nolointa ikinä miehelle
On ghostata nainen jonka kanssa on ollut ystävä tai ollu orastavaa tapailua pidemmän aikaa. Osoittaa sellaista moukkamai1814845- 1213570
- 692733
Sattuma ja muutama väärinkäsitys
vaikuttivat siihen millaiseksi tämä kaikki muodostui. Pienet aikanaan huomaamattomat käänteet. Seuraava näytös on jo tul552542On sillä rääpyä
Tuo ex kuntajohtaja Lea Tolonen kehtaakin tulla Ähtäriin. Ajoi laivan Karille. Kari Heikkilä oikaisi taloutta, sai laiva211983- 341624
Toisesta ketjusta syntyi ajatuksia
Annan lähes koko elämäni hänen vuokseen. Alan miettiä olenko menettänyt järkeni enkä vain huomaa sitä? Hyväkin asia mikä141293- 101274
- 101232